| Description: |
Dwarf epiphytic herb. Pseudobulbs oblong to conical, 10–15 mm high, ribbed, somewhat flattened bilaterally, 2-leaved. Leaves linear, 4–14 cm long, slightly 2-lobed at the apex. Inflorescence 2.5–5.5 cm tall, densely many-flowered. Flowers very small, greenish-yellow or whitish, tinged with purple, often not opening but apparently self fertilizing. Bracts 4–7 mm long. Dorsal sepal ovate, 1.6–2 mm long, acuminate; lateral sepals obliquely ovate, 2–3.5 mm long, acuminate. Petals narrowly oblong, 1.25 mm long. Lip 3-lobed in the basal half, 1.3–2.3 mm long, with a hairless callus at the junction of the lobes; mid-lobe ovate, c. 1 mm long; side lobes rounded, erect. |

| Notes: | This species is very similar to Polystachya adansoniae and can be distinguished by smaller flowers and a hairless callus on the lip. |
| Derivation of specific name: | stuhlmannii: named after Franz Ernst Stuhlmann, one time Acting Governor of Tanganyika and an avid collector of plants. |
| Habitat: | Evergreen forest and high rainfall Brachystegia woodland |
| Altitude range: (metres) | 900 - 1550 m |
| Flowering time: | |
| Worldwide distribution: | Gabon, DRC, Uganda, Tanzania, Malawi, Mozambique, Zambia and Zimbabwe. |
